“I’m a handsome, gray 15-year-old kitty looking for a retire- ment home. Troy adores people and will talk to you until you pet him. Troy is a very loving boy that does well with other cats, but no dogs please. If you can love and spoil him through his golden years please call us for more information or go to our website s and fill out an application.”

“I’m a 7-year-old spayed female. I find myself at Lucy Mackenzie because of some adjustments my previous home needed to make, due to no fault of mine. I am slowly coming out of my shell and transitioning to this change, but it is quite different. I am a shy gal and would love to find a peaceful, quiet forever home. Perhaps you, too, are looking for a gentle, soft companion to keep you company on these lovely fall nights and beyond. If a calm soul like me sounds like what’s missing from your home, please call today to learn more!”
